Boreal dwarves (or Enutanik) are a sub-race of dwarves in Pillars of Eternity and Pillars of Eternity II: Deadfire.

Origin and prevalence[edit | edit source]
Enutanik (eh-NOO-tah-nik, “people of the tundra” in Enutanik), commonly known as Boreal dwarves, are originally from a southern Boreal region. Most boreal dwarves live in the remote southern island of Naasitaq, where they share the rocky tundra and snow-covered forests with migratory pale elves who drift near the shoreline and the coast-hugging ships of aumaua.
Boreal dwarves are extremely rare in Aedyr, more common in the Vailian Republics, and seldom encountered in the Dyrwood or Readceras.[1][2]
Appearance and culture[edit | edit source]
Like their northern cousins, Enutanik share an instinctive drive to explore and cover long distances in spite of their small stature.
From the Pillars of Eternity Guidebook: Volume One:
- Features: Moderately wide, flat noses. Broad, flat, round faces. Almond, downturned, or thin eyes with epicanthic folds. Shallow-set eyes, not-prominent brows.
- Skin: Tan to dark tan, tough and leathery, often creased even among the young
- Hair: Auburn, brown, black, gray. Straight, thin
- Eyes: Hazel, brown, gold, copper, deep violet, black.

Gameplay[edit | edit source]
Boreal dwarves are one of the playable races. Their racial bonus talent is:
- In Pillars of Eternity
- Hunter's Instincts: Boreal dwarves gain +15 accuracy against any creature of the Wilder or Primordial types.
- In Deadfire
- Hunter's Instincts: 50% of Misses converted to Grazes against Primordial and Wilder enemies.
